摘要
以发酵工业废水为原料提出菌体 ,将其部分水解后 ,所得水解蛋白液作为酸洗缓蚀剂。采用失重法研究了它在盐酸、硫酸溶液中对钢、铝的缓蚀效率。认定其在盐酸、硫酸溶液中对钢有较好的缓蚀作用 ,以及同六次甲基四胺复配后良好的缓蚀协同作用。
Using the fermented industrial waste water as raw material to extract bacteria, then to acquire protein hydrolysate from the bacteria by partial hydrolysis, to use the protein hydrolysate acquired as inhibitor. We studies its efficency on corrosion inhibition to steel and aluminum in the solutions of hydrochloric acid and the solutions of sulphuric acid by the weight loss method,maintains its fine effect in the solutions of hydrochloric acid and the solutions of sulphuric acid, also maintains its fine synergistic effects on corrosion inhibition after compound with methenamine.
